Author: Atteeq ur rahman
Introduction:
Mobile applications serve a variety of purposes in our daily lives, ranging from productivity and money to communication and enjoyment. The necessity to protect mobile apps from various threats is growing along with the usage of these apps. Words like “AppSealing” have become more common in this context. This article examines these keywords and discusses how they improve mobile app security.
What is AppSealing?
App Sealing is similar to providing your mobile application with a virtual bodyguard. App Sealing is all about implementing an extra defensive mechanism for the code and data that make up a mobile application, much way we use security measures to protect our houses. It’s similar to securing an app against dangers and invasions with a thick barrier. App Sealing upgrades its security and adjusts as cyber threats change.
How Does AppSealing Work?
Consider your mobile app as a storage space for valuable data. App Sealing locks and secures this precious chest using a variety of techniques. Techniques for tamper detection, hiding, and encryption are used. To put it another way, encryption works similarly to encoding your data with a secret code that only your app and you can read. Rearranging the phrases of a book to make it more difficult for someone to read is similar to misdirection. Installing an alarm and using tamper detection is similar in that when someone attempts to tamper with the app, the alert goes off.
Why is App Sealing Important?
Consider your mobile app to be a renowned superhero. Just as superheroes meet villains, mobile applications face cyber threats. App Sealing becomes important because it helps the app survive these threats. Cyberattacks have become more frequent, shielding for the app is like equipping your superhero with the best armor to defend the city.
The Guardian’s Arsenal: App Shielding and ProGuard
1. App Sealing: The Primary Protective Measure
Using a range of strategies to make it difficult for attackers to access and modify the program’s code is known as shielding the application. It acts as a barrier that keeps hackers and attackers out, acting as the initial line of protection. App shielding is covering the application with encryption and crypto to thwart attackers’ attempts to reverse engineer or mess with it.
2. ProGuard: The Protector Without Noise
ProGuard is a Java application shrinker and obfuscator. It is essential for reducing the application’s size and increasing its removal difficulty. ProGuard, however, primarily seeks to minimize code size, and its obfuscation powers significantly enhance overall program security.
Conclusion:
In summary, mobile application security, app shielding, and app sealing come together to create an entire picture of the security of programs on mobile devices. The increasing use of mobile applications has made it more difficult for developers to safeguard their creations against advanced attacks. Mobile developers may significantly enhance the security status of their applications by utilizing a multi-layered strategy that incorporates advanced techniques like app shielding, RASP, and encryption. Active and dynamic security measures are essential in today’s world of constant cyber threats because they preserve user confidence, safeguard sensitive data, and ensure the continued growth of mobile applications.